NEON, in collaboration with the Embassy of Greece in London, presents the exhibition Doomed companions, unsubstantial shades at the Hellenic Residence in London. The exhibition brings together the legacy of Nobel laureate Greek poet and diplomat Giorgos Seferis with the work of twelve Greek-speaking contemporary artists reflecting on the themes of identity, nostalgia and trauma in the current socio-political condition.
Doomed Companions, unsubstantial shades wholeheartedly embraces the topic of diaspora, and aspires to establish a connection between the experiences, the worldview and the work of Giorgos Seferis and the works of contemporary artists who share a common language and migratory experiences.
Participating artists | Ellie Antoniou, Irini Bachlitzanaki, Savvas Christodoulides, Nikos Kessanlis, Karolina Krasouli, Amanda Kyritsopoulou, Stathis Logothetis, Maro Michalakakos, Yorgos Petrou, Erica Scourti, Stefania Strouza, Antrea Tzourovits.
Curator | Akis Kokkinos, NEON scholarship alumnus
Most of the young artists and the exhibition curator are members of the NEON alumni community as beneficiaries of Postgraduate and Doctoral Scholarships.
